The first factor to consider is the type of scale used. There are different types of scales available, such as mechanical scales, digital scales, and laboratory balances. Mechanical scales are the simplest and least expensive option, but they are not as accurate as digital or laboratory balances. Digital scales offer better accuracy and are more commonly used in commercial settings. Laboratory balances, on the other hand, are highly precise and are used in scientific research and quality control. The cost of these scales can range from a few dollars for a basic mechanical scale to several thousand dollars for a high-precision laboratory balance.

Another factor that affects the cost of weighing a pound is the frequency of use. If you only need to weigh items occasionally, a less expensive scale may suffice. However, if you require precise measurements on a regular basis, investing in a more accurate and durable scale is essential. The cost of maintaining and calibrating the scale also needs to be considered, as this can add to the overall expense.

The type of material being weighed plays a role in the cost as well. Some materials, such as precious metals or chemicals, are more valuable and require specialized scales that can handle their unique properties. These scales are often more expensive and may require additional safety measures to prevent accidents or damage.
